Tips and Details
- Call of Ruin is unlocked through the High Branch Skill Quest.
- The quest can be obtained at Lv32 from Camilla, the PvP NPC.
Trivia
- This skill also has tendency to miss on the explosion
- Sometimes in PvP the last hit connects and the damage is displayed but the enemy doesn't lose any health, most likely due to lag.
- The slice damage, just before the spheres explosion, can be used to activate Vital Point Piercing, giving the last hit Critical damage.
